(la the Estate of Robert Gordon Johnstone, deceased.) TO BE HELD IN~DALGETY AND GOJS ROOMS, MASTERTON. SATURDAY, Ist JULY, 1911, At 12 Noon. /TiBSSRS DALGETY AND CO., Ltd., (under instructions from the executors in the 'above Estate), will sell by public auction at the above time'and irjlace— The Valuable Freehold Property, containing 242 Acres, being Lot 12 of Deposited Plan No. 1552, part of Te Weraiti Block, Otahoua District. This highly improved farm is parti of the welf known Weraiti Estate, and is five miles distant from Mastertan by Main Road.. Al heavy limestone country, admirably adapted for dairying or fattening purModern 7-jßoomed house with all conveniences, woolshed buggy .shed, .stable, and dip. • Splendid orchard; 60 acres have hpfm under tlie plough. TERMS- TWO THIRDS of the .Purchase Money can remain for fave •or seven years at 5 per cent. Appointments can be made by appointment for intending purchasers to be shown over the property.
